In the conference call, NEA mentioned that they were doing enhanced services (i.e. upgrade to premium content) for free for all customers, and were negotiating with some smaller companies facing difficulties. The latter can't be material, as trading conditions were steady, and the former does not have any cash implications for NEA.
The advantage of the free upgrade is that some of these customers will realise that these premium services are good for their business. They are then likely to pay a higher contract price later than they would have otherwise. All good IMO.
